虚拟币市场中的Bug解析:是什么,它如何影响交
什么是虚拟币中的Bug?
在虚拟币的交易及应用中,“Bug”通常指的是系统或程序中的错误或漏洞。这些Bug可能会导致交易失误、数据错误,甚至安全漏洞,进而影响用户的资产安全或交易的正常进行。虚拟币由于其去中心化特性,一旦出现Bug,可能会对整个生态系统造成巨大影响。
虚拟币中的Bug如何产生?
Bug的产生通常与软件开发的复杂性、代码的冗长反复、代码审查的不合格等因素有关。在虚拟币的开发中,开发团队往往需要处理大量的代码,任何小小的疏忽都可能导致程序出现Bug。此外,开发团队可能在面临时间压力和资源限制时,更多地依赖于快速迭代而非充分测试,增加了Debugging阶段将要面对的挑战。
虚拟币Bug的常见类型
在虚拟币市场中,常见的Bug类型包括交易所的安全漏洞、合约中的逻辑错误、区块链上的数据不一致等。其中,安全漏洞通常是影响最为广泛的,因为一旦黑客利用了这些漏洞,可能会导致大量用户资产的损失。
Bug对虚拟币市场的影响
Bug不仅可能导致资产的直接损失,还可能对市场的信誉产生负面影响。一旦一个币种或平台因为Bug而受到攻击,投资者对该项目的信任度将下降,可能导致价格的快速下跌。此外,负面新闻会对整个市场产生连锁反应,特别是在小众币种中,短期内可能出现更大的价格波动。
如何预防和修复虚拟币中的Bug?
要有效预防和修复虚拟币中的Bug,项目方必须在开发过程中保持高标准的质量控制。这包括进行全面的代码审查、使用自动化测试工具进行回归测试,以及通过黑客攻击模拟进行安全测试。此外,众多项目亦会进行第三方审计,以确保代码的安全性和可靠性。
真实案例分析:虚拟币中的Bug事件
分析一些真实案例有助于加深对虚拟币Bug影响的理解。例如,在2016年,DAO(去中心化自治组织)因代码中的Bug被黑客攻击,损失了价值超过5000万美元的以太币。这种事件不仅对DAO本身造成了巨大的损失,还引发了以太坊社区关于硬分叉的争论,从而导致了以太坊和以太坊经典两个链的分裂。
总结: 上述各章节详细介绍了虚拟币中的Bug的定义、来源、类型、影响,以及预防修复措施。同时,案例分析让人更加直观地理解了Bug在虚拟币领域的重要性。在如今这个数字化快速发展的时代,关注和理解这些问题对参与虚拟币交易的人显得尤为重要。通过不断提升项目质量和用户教育,才能更好地保护个人资产免受Bug带来的风险。